Johnson County has an unemployment rate of 5.9%. The US average is 6.0%.
Johnson County has seen the job market decrease by -2.0% over the last year. Future job growth over the next ten years is predicted to be 23.4%, which is lower than the US average of 33.5%.
Tax Rates for Johnson County
- The Sales Tax Rate for Johnson County is 5.0%. The US average is 7.3%.
- The Income Tax Rate for Johnson County is 0.0%. The US average is 4.6%.

Income and Salaries for Johnson County
- The average income of a Johnson County resident is $34,737 a year. The US average is $37,638 a year.
- The Median household income of a Johnson County resident is $58,020 a year. The US average is $69,021 a year.
